Oldest known frescoes of apostles found in Rome catacomb
Archaeologists and restorers working in a little-known catacomb in south Rome have uncovered what they say are the oldest known paintings of the apostles Peter, Paul, Andrew and John. The four full-face icons are datable to the second half of the fourth century AD.
